Day 1 Ho Chi Minh City (D)

Arrive at anytime. Transfer to hotel and arrival dinner included.

Day 2 Mekong Delta (B,L,D)

Travel to the "rice basket" of Vietnam — the Mekong Delta. A full day of discovery, visiting small villages and local farms on the river, an introductory Vietnamese language lesson and overnight on a traditional boat

Days 3-4 Ho Chi Minh City (2B)

More exploration of the Delta, through waterways and floating markets before returning to frantic Ho Chi Minh City. On Day 4 we visit the famous Cu Chi Tunnels, which were legendary during the 1960's when they played a vital part in the Vietnam war.

Days 5-7 Hoi An (3B,1L,1D)

Flight to the World Heritage town of Hoi An. On day 6, travel by boat to Duy Hai village and visit an authentic wholesale fish market, enjoying a local breakfast. Tour around the countryside by bike, visiting a local family for some snacks before returning for our a cooking class. On Day 7, an excursion to visit the ancient Champa ruins of My Son accompanied by a local expert guide.

Days 8-9 Hue (2B,1D)

Travel via the Hai Van scenic Pass to Hue. Enjoy a Perfume River cruise on a Dragon boat and visit the Citadel, Tu Duc Tomb and savor a Royal Buffet dinner.

Day 10 Hanoi (B)

Morning flight to the Capital of Vietnam. Guided tour of Hoa Lo Prison (Hanoi Hilton) and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um followed by a cyclo tour of the old quarter and a Water Puppets performance.

Day 11 Halong Bay (B,L,D)

Travel to Halong Bay for cruise and overnight on a traditional boat. With our local guide we explore caves and an island lookout. A fresh seafood lunch and dinner are included.

Days 12-13 Hanoi (2B,1L)

After our morning on the bay, travel back to Hanoi. More time to explore or shop the back streets of this intriguing city and take optional tours.

Day 14 Hanoi (B)

Depart anytime today
